Indi Kaur is an Integrative Psychotherapist and Counsellor with an MSc in Integrative Psychotherapy, accredited by the UK Council for Psychotherapy (UKCP) and a registered member of the British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y (BACP). She also holds a qualification as an ABNLP Life Coach. Kaur has experience working within various NHS mental health roles, including primary care (IAPT), staff counselling, and services bridging primary and secondary care, as well as a tertiary service for the homeless population. Her approach is trauma-aware, and she aims to support clients in making positive life changes, fostering a sense of inner peace and calm. Kaur is committed to her own professional development and personal betterment through supervision, training, and self-reflection. She offers in-person sessions on Thursdays in Birmingham and remote sessions on Wednesdays, available nationally.
